A close friend who knows the local food scene well recommended this place, and I'm glad I took their advice. The first thing you notice is the massive wooden door. It looks dignified, yet slightly intimidating, and most people probably hesitate for a moment before touching it. I did too. However, the atmosphere changes instantly once you step inside. The staff welcome you right away, and when you leave, they take the time to see you off. You can sense that hospitality is taken seriously here, and this sets the tone for the entire experience. The owner-chef may appear strict and reserved in his online profile, the kind of craftsman who speaks little and focuses solely on technique. In reality, however, he is friendly, relaxed, and surprisingly funny. After one visit, it becomes clear why people return again and again. The restaurant offers a single menu, priced reasonably for the quality. Every dish features ingredients that he personally selects from the market, including seasonal fish paired with the finest vegetables. Since the menu changes daily, each visit feels unique. The interior is just as memorable. Large, single-slab wooden counter, tables and warm textures create a calm, refined space that feels both special and comfortable. Having worked in major cities across Japan, the chef's experience is evident in the precision of every dish. Nothing is flashy, yet nothing feels lacking. Even the soba noodles are handmade in-house daily, adding another layer of authenticity to the meal. Small side dishes arrive one after another, naturally encouraging you to keep eating. The flavours are gentle yet deeply satisfying, and would pair beautifully with drinks for those who enjoy them. Even the restroom is surprisingly elegant and immaculately clean, reflecting the restaurant's high standards. This is the kind of place that turns a meal into a memorable occasion rather than just dinner. Meal type: Dinner Price per person: ¥7,000–8,000 Food: 5 Service: 5 Atmosphere: 5
